What does a marketing advertising associate do?
Career: Marketing Advertising Associate
A Marketing Advertising Associate supports the development and execution of advertising campaigns and marketing strategies. Their responsibilities often include conducting market research, coordinating with creative teams, analyzing campaign performance, and assisting with project management tasks. They help ensure advertising materials align with brand guidelines and target the right audience. Additionally, they may handle administrative tasks like scheduling and reporting, making them an essential part of the marketing team.
